Registration For New a Political Party

A. According to Section 135(2)(a) of the Electoral Act 5 of 2014 the principal object of a political party should be to participate in and promote elections under the Act, including:

  • The nomination of persons as candidates for any such elections in accordance with the provisions of the Act;
  • The canvassing for votes for a candidate at any such elections;
  • The devotion of any of its funds or any part thereof to the election expenses of any candidate taking part in an election;

B. Objects of a political party:

  • May not be prejudicial to the security of the State, sovereignty and integrity, the public safety, welfare or the peace and good order;
  • May not be contrary to the laws of Namibia;
  • May not exclude or restrict membership on the grounds of sex, race, colour, ethnic origin, religion, creed or social or economic status;
  • May not use or include words, slogans or symbols which could give rise to division on any basis specified in the above mentioned paragraph;
  • May not provide for discriminatory practices contrary to the Namibian constitution or any other law;
  • May not accept or advocate the use of force or violence as a means of attaining its political objectives;
  • May not advocate or aim to carry on its political activities exclusively on one part of Namibia;
  • May not advocate or aim to carry on its political activities on the grounds or sex, race, colour, ethnic origin, religion, creed or social or economic status;
  • Must provide for regular, periodic and open election of its office bearers.

C. A person who is not a Namibian citizen may not be appointed to and may not accept appointment as an elected office-bearer of a political party.

D. Furthermore, the application must be accompanied by:

  • Written proof of the principal objects and other objects of the applicant contemplated in section 135(2)(a) and (b). (Explained in A and B above)
  • Proof of payment of the amount of N$ 25 000 for registration;
  • A copy of the party’s constitution; and
  • A declaration signed by at least 3500 persons, distributed evenly from a minimum of seven of the regions in Namibia (i.e. 500 per region) whose names appear on the national voters’ register to the effect that these voters support the registration of the political party. This declaration must also contain the full names and voter registration numbers of the persons who have signed the declaration and the names and number of the regions and constituencies in respect of which the signatories are registered.

E. In addition, the following particulars must appear on the application form:

  • The name of the political party;
  • An abbreviation of its name to appear on the ballot paper for an election concerned, the abbreviated name of the political party;
  • The full names and signature of the person who for the purposes of the Act is the proposed authorized representative of the political party;
  • A complete list of the names and addresses of its other proposed office-bearers;
  • The proposed business address and postal address in Namibia of the proposed office which for the purposes of this Act is the office of the proposed authorized representative of the political party; and
  • The political party symbol to appear on the ballot paper referred to above, the distinctive symbol of the political party.
